Washington state offers a number of casino and wagering possibilities. Many Washington casinos controlled by local Native American bands are cleverly placed near highways or Washington cities. 27 Washington casinos are owned in Amerindian lands. Each of Washington’s casinos provide slot machines, roulette, blackjack, craps, and video poker. Other gaming tables, like baccarat chemin de fer, poker in assorted forms, off-track betting, keno, and bingo are playable at a number of casinos. The wagering age changes by casino, with some approving of gambling at eighteen, and others not until 21years of age. A couple of other casinos operate in Washington, as well, like card rooms, or so-called mini-casinos. There are numerous horse tracks in Washington, and wagering is permitted at all of them.

Twenty-four of Washington state’s twenty-seven tribal casinos also provide a computerized form of scratch off lotto tickets. These gaming machines have a 5 dollar cap and operate using cards bought at the casino, as opposed to cash. The min payout on these machines is legally 75%, set by the state. Washington casinos are required to report pay outs on video slots.

Washington casinos range from tiny freestanding operations to large resorts with hotels, restaurants, beauty salons, and entertainment. A couple of the Washington casinos with get-a-ways would make a good home base for a longer vacation, allowing you to experience the natural wonder of Washington state and make day trips into large cities for sightseeing. Las Vegas esque displays and productions are available at some Washington casinos.

Washington’s gambling laws permit an adequate amount of leeway with regards to approved gambling in Washington casinos, as well as allowing for charitable wagering. Net gaming, however, is not legal in Washington and is a class C felony. Net horse wagering is acceptable in a handful of conditions. Free or practice money internet wagering is still legal.
